No, let me explain. What I meant was if you, having an account of Ebay, wanted to sell a used item or something which you could easily put a few Kronas in your pocket, you could easily place an ad with pictures and a full explanation. To give you an idea, bought a Microsoft TouchMouse and just couldn't get used to the idea of swiping my finger all over it, so I posted an ad for it on Ebay. A guy in Brazil eventually bought it, and Paypal paid me. The other file was about selling, the one you have concerns buying.

Regarding the price of the freight, which I too believe is high, do this -- look for any more modern video card as if you were going to buy it. You'll notice there will be many vendors selling it. Compare their freight rates to Sweden and see what you come up with. For simply browsing, no login or password are needed -- that's required only if you buy or sell. You can also get rates online from carriers such as UPS, Fedex or DHL for (for example), a 1-kg box which measures 20 x 10 x 7 cm, from Texas, USA to your city. If you see that the freight rates are significantly lower, you can write this vendor an e-mail and complain about that. Remember, he wants to sell the card and he'll probably go with a better freight rate if one exists.

Naturally all this assumes you've looked all over the net and haven't found the damn thing anywhere, and that absolutely no other card will do the job.
